Bright Blueberry Balsamic Vinaigrette

Ingredients
ยผ cup (60 ml) balsamic vinegar
ยฝ cup (118 ml) olive oil
ยผ cup (62 g) dijon mustard
1 Tablespoon (15 ml) maple syrup
1 cup (150 g) blueberries, fresh or frozen
Freshly ground black pepper, to taste
Directions
- Add all ingredients to the blender container.
- Blend on high speed for 60 seconds.
- Pour over your favorite salad.
Notes
- This dressing pairs well with various salads. Try it on a salad of spinach, quinoa, beets, slivered almonds, and dried blueberries.
- If you prefer a milder dijon flavor, use half the amount of mustard.
- For a brighter color, substitute white balsamic vinegar for the traditional dark balsamic vinegar.
- Store any leftover dressing in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to one week.
